Beach Bungalows in Thailand with Safes?

by LeBeach

Will be in thailand in May: Phuket, Koh Phi Phi, Koh Samui and Koh Phangan (3 weeks).

Will be looking to stay in bungalows BUT will also have an expensive SLR camera with me. Do the bungalows have safes? If not, will they let you use a safe in the main building? Can you recommend bungalows with safes on (some of) those islands?

Thank you!

Re: Beach Bungalows in Thailand with Safes?

by NiamhMC

Hi I have been in Koh Samui and Koh Phangan.
Al's Resort in Chaweng beach are really nice and cheap and have safes in the room.
For Koh Phangan I stayed in Blue Hill Resort they have they're safes in the reception and advise never to keep your valuables in the rooms when you are not there especially when the full moon is on most places are at risk...

Re: Beach Bungalows in Thailand with Safes?

by Deacz

I stopped in Chaweng in Samui at a bungalow site called Matlang. It had lockers in the resturant part of the complex. seemed safe enough, but i would recomend buying a padlock before hand or they will sell you a cheapo one for 100 baht. Cheap and cheerfull place but a long way to walk to Chaweng central. You are not far from the beach and could have a leisurely walk that way, but avoiding falling in the sea after dark like I did on the way back.

Re: Beach Bungalows in Thailand with Safes?

by bjsamui

Lipa Loveley on the west coast of Samui has individual safes in the office.
They have also started getting them fitted in to the rooms.
It's right on the beach and has nice bungalows not too expensive.

Be careful just asking if a hotel has room safes. Some are for passports and money only, not big enough for an SLR. You need to ask what size it is too.
